What's The Definition Of Buckler?

buckler in American English
a small, round shield held by a handle or worn on the arm
to protect by shielding; defend
noun: a round shield held by a grip and sometimes having straps through which the arm is passed
transitive verb: to be a shield to; support; defend

buckler in British English
noun: a small round shield worn on the forearm or held by a short handle
verb: to defend
